You’re right – the really toxic chemicals aren’t able to be shipped in the same container, and there’s often additional charges to ship hazardous stuff like NaOH and HCl.  However, we’ve got videos on how to make both of those using the chemicals already inside the set.  You will need to get denatured alcohol from the drug store (it’s much cheaper that way). 

Do NOT buy Sulfuric Acid from an auto parts store, as the container you’re given has way more than you’ll ever use, and pouring it is impossible to do without splashing (and in this case, it will also eat clear through your skin).  It’s really nasty stuff to work with, so we suggest getting it already in its own container from a science supply store.  There are links on Shopping List Unit 15 for where to get each additional chemical, how to store them, etc.  You’ll need to learn how to safely store each one (some chemicals should not even be near each other). 

I would recommend skipping the advanced ones now and simply picking up the alcohol at the store for your burner.  You’ll have plenty to do without the nasty ones, and after your kids demonstrate safe chemical handling, you can feel more comfortable getting the more dangerous ones. Does that help?</description>
